About 7,8-bis(4-chlorophenyl)-2-[(3-oxo-2H-[1,2,4]triazolo[4,3-a]pyridin-7-yl)methyl]-[1,2,4]triazolo[4,3-b]pyridazin-3-one

7,8-bis(4-chlorophenyl)-2-[(3-oxo-2H-[1,2,4]triazolo[4,3-a]pyridin-7-yl)methyl]-[1,2,4]triazolo[4,3-b]pyridazin-3-one (PubChem CID 59716853) has the molecular formula C24H15Cl2N7O2 and a molecular weight of 504.34 g/mol. Its IUPAC name is 7,8-bis(4-chlorophenyl)-2-[(3-oxo-2H-[1,2,4]triazolo[4,3-a]pyridin-7-yl)methyl]-[1,2,4]triazolo[4,3-b]pyridazin-3-one.
